What is Insurability Form
The Evidence of Insurability Form is a medical consent document used by employees, spouses, and children to provide health information for insurance underwriting purposes.

Who Needs to Complete the Evidence of Insurability Form?
This form must be completed by several key individuals within an insured family. Required participants include the employee, their spouse, and any dependent children, particularly when health disclosures are necessary. Specific conditions, such as applying for supplemental coverage or if an individual exceeds certain age brackets, necessitate that these specific health inquiries be addressed through the evidence of insurability form.
Key Features and Sections of the Evidence of Insurability Form
The Evidence of Insurability Form consists of multiple sections that capture essential information for life insurance underwriting. Key sections include:
-
Personal information
-
Health-related questions
-
Authorizations for medical record release
Completing each section thoroughly is vital to prevent any delays in processing the application. Accuracy in this medical history form directly impacts the outcome of life insurance underwriting processes.

Who is eligible to complete the Evidence of Insurability Form?
Employees, their spouses, and dependent children are all eligible to complete the Evidence of Insurability Form, providing necessary health details for insurance purposes.
What is the deadline for submitting the Evidence of Insurability Form?
While specific deadlines may vary by employer, it is generally advisable to submit the Evidence of Insurability Form promptly to ensure timely processing of insurance coverage applications.
How can I submit the completed Evidence of Insurability Form?
The completed Evidence of Insurability Form can be submitted by returning it to your employer, who will forward it to the insurance company, or submitted directly through pdfFiller if e-filing is acceptable.
What kind of supporting documents do I need for the form?
Typically, supporting documents like previous medical records or identification may be required, especially if your medical history is complex or if specific health conditions need clarification.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include incomplete answers, incorrect personal information, and failing to sign. It’s crucial to review the form thoroughly before submitting.
How long does it take to process the Evidence of Insurability Form?
Processing times vary but expect it to take a few weeks, depending on the insurance company’s workload and your employer's submission speed.
